About Marisol D. Labas

Marisol D. Labas is a scholar working on Water Science and Technology,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Biotechnology and Pollution, having authored 21 papers that have together received 440 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ced oxidation water treatment (11 papers), Water Quality Monitoring and Analysis (9 papers), Water Treatment and Disinfection (6 papers), Listeria monocytogenes in Food Safety (4 papers),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(3 papers), TiO2 Photocatalysis and Solar Cells (3 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(3 papers) and Infection Control and Ventilation (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Water Science and Technology (186 citations),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(97 cit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(124 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(99 citations) and Pollution (74 citations). Marisol D. Labas has collaborated with scholars based in Argentina, Portugal and Brazil. Frequent co-authors include Rodolfo J. Brandi, Alberto E. Cassano, Cristina Susana Zalazar, Carlos A. Martín, Orlando M. Alfano, Maia Lescano, C. Dianne Martin, A. E. Cassano, Vítor J.P. Vilar and Belisa A. Marinho. Their work appears in journals such as Chemical Engineering Journal, Water Science & Technology, Chemosphere, Journal of environmental chemical engineering and Journal of Photochemistry and Photobiology B Biology.
